First Steps to Fix a Scanner Not Reading Your Car Computer
Don’t panic. Before you buy anything new, try these simple checks. I always start here, and it often solves the problem fast.
Double-Check Your Basic Connections
It sounds silly, but loose connections are the top cause. Ensure your OBD2 cable is fully plugged into the car’s port under the dash. Wiggle it to be sure.
Also, turn your ignition to the “ON” position. The engine doesn’t need to run, but the dashboard lights should be on. Your scanner needs power from the car.
Verify Your Vehicle and Scanner Compatibility
Not all scanners work on all cars. Grab your scanner’s manual or look up its model online. Check its supported vehicle list or protocols.
Common protocols are CAN, ISO, or KWP. Your car likely uses CAN if it’s from 2008 or newer. An older scanner might not have this update.
Here’s a quick list of what to verify:
- Your car’s exact make, model, and year.
- Your scanner’s model and its latest firmware version.
- Whether you need a specific adapter for Asian or European cars.

The Mistake I See People Make With Car Scanners
The biggest mistake is buying the cheapest scanner on the shelf. You think you’re saving money, but you’re buying future frustration. These basic tools often lack the software to talk to newer or specific car computers.
Another error is not checking for your car’s exact year before buying. A 2015 model might use a different system than a 2014. That one-year difference can mean your new scanner is useless.
Instead, do a quick online search. Type your car’s make, model, year, and “OBD2 protocol” into a search engine. This tells you what language your car speaks. Then, only look at scanners that list that protocol.

Why won’t my scanner connect to my car at all?
This is usually a simple connection or power issue. First, check that the OBD2 plug is fully seated in your car’s port under the dash. A loose connection is the most common culprit.
Next, ensure your ignition is in the “ON” position. Your dashboard lights should be illuminated. The scanner needs power from the car’s battery to turn on and communicate.
How can I tell if my scanner is compatible with my car?
You need to check two things: your scanner’s specifications and your car’s protocol. Look up your scanner model online to see its list of supported vehicles and communication protocols.
Then, search for your car’s exact make, model, and year along with “OBD2 protocol.” If your car uses a protocol like CAN and your older scanner doesn’t support it, they won’t talk.

Can I update my old scanner to make it work?
Sometimes, yes. Check the manufacturer’s website for your scanner model. If they offer a firmware or software update, installing it might add the protocol your car needs.
However, many budget scanners have no update path. Their hardware can’t support new protocols. In that case, an upgrade is your only real solution.
